Can A Vacuum Sealer Be Used To Seal ‘regular’ Plastic Bags?
I am wondering if a vacuum sealer like the Food Saver or the Rival Seal-a-Meal can be used to seal regular plastic bags. I don’t necessarily need the air to be vacuumed out but I want to be able to reseal stuff like pepperoni or hotdogs or stuff from the freezer like chicken fingers etc (in their original packaging).
Has anyone tried this? I would not imagine it would not damage the sealer (as long as the plastic is thick enough).

You can seal most plastic bags with the sealer, you just won’t be able to vacuum them to well. Go to ebay and buy premade bags in bulk. I seal up all kind of stuff in these bags.
